From our CEO: Update on Novel Coronavirus (COVID-19)

As we continue to monitor the rapidly changing developments regarding the Novel Coronavirus (COVID-19), effective today, Wednesday, March 18th The Elson Redmond Memorial Driving Range will be closed until further notice. The safety of participants, patrons, employees, and volunteers is First Tee of Greater Richmond’s top priority. We intend to maintain our facilities with limited personnel on-site and will support our many other functions by working remotely where possible.
